Albion/Medina opened its B1 Division schedule on a high note this evening as the OC Rivals downed Lake Shore 42-19 at Vets Park.

The OC Rivals attack included three touchdown passes by quarterback Preston Woodworth on completions to Elijah Doxey, Noah Harrison and Hadrian Batista along with two rushing touchdowns by Doxey and one by Woodworth.

Albion/Medina wasted little time in getting on the scoreboard as Doxey took a short swing pass from Woodworth and raced 58 yards up the sideline for a touchdown on the Rivals first play from scrimmage.

The Rivals upped the lead to 18-13 at the end of the opening quarter which also saw Doxey run 29 yards for touchdown and Woodworth hook up with Harrison for a 48 yard TD pass completion. Harrison had a 20 yard run and Jayzon Wills a 13 yard pickup to help set up Doxey’s TD run.

Lake Shore’s two touchdowns in the quarter came on a pair of kickoff returns covering 75 and 70 yards.

Albion/Medina enjoyed a 34-13 half-time advantage after second quarter touchdown runs of 9 yards by Doxey and 1 yard by Woodworth. A big 27 yard pass completion from Woodworth to Doxey helped set up Woodworth’s short TD run.

The Rivals lone second half touchdown came on a 20 yard Woodworth to Batista scoring pass early in the final quarter.

Now at 2-0 overall, Albion /Medina next visits Williamsville South next Friday evening at 7. South upped its B1 record to 2-0 with a 69-13 win over Lew-Port on Thursday evening.

Lake Shore is now 0-2 in the division.
